BHS e434-Frank Curtis, West Brattleboro Inventor
from The Brattleboro Historical Society Podcast · host Brattleboro Historical Society
In the late 1800's French Canadian immigrant Frank Curtis invented a machine that could automatically make screws. He and his sons would go on to refine the machining components and further develop his invention. Eventually, the machining platform developed by Curtis would be used to create products for a variety of industries. Today, many vehicles around the world contain Curtis-manufactured parts.
